Variety reported, but a judge ruled she’s free to release it as planned.Megan, 26, had plans to drop the song Friday, however, she filed a court order Tuesday claiming the company won’t allow it.
Documents stated that the “Body” singer sought “emergency relief from the Court before this Friday, August 27, 2021, to allow her new music to be released this week as previously scheduled.”She also argued in the docs that preventing the release of the song would cause “irreparable damage” to her career.Megan uses her birth name — Megan Pete — in the court filing.
